The Oklahoma State Department of Education (OSDE) is recruiting community volunteers to provide literacy tutoring and enrichment activities to elementary schools in our state. The OSDE is working with several large districts and districts that currently operate expanded learning grant sites to expand tutoring for students during holiday breaks and will provide a toolkit for community tutors to use with students. Several in-person and online training options will be available for tutors. This is an amazing opportunity for community members to support their local community and grow relationships with their local school district.
